Hi,
right now I am running freeBSD 6.2 RELEASE with xorg 6.9 and I am
unable to get xorg (icewm) to detect my mouse.
~comperr
Is moused running? And if it is, how is it configured?
See the FreeBSD handbook and the moused manpage for details:
http://www.freebsd.org/doc/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/handbook/install-post.html#MOUSE
Which brand/model mouse do you have? And how does the mouse connect to
your PC (PS2 or USB)?
What are your mouse settings in /etc/X11/xorg.conf
sorry about the time delay:
um it is a generic PS2 mouse made by digiView
I tried running the xorg config wizard a few tmes choosing different
mouse types each time. None of them work.
as for xorg.conf
Section "InputDevice"
Identifier "Mouse0"
Driver "mouse"
Option "Protocall" "Auto"
Option "Device" "/dev/sysmouse"
(side point) if someone would tell me how to copy and paste with only
a keyboard that would be really nice
Does the mouse work in the console ("DOS-screen")?
xorg usually isn't the problem, it much more often moused which isn't
running or badly configured.
Try running:
moused -t auto -p /dev/psm0
Before starting xorg, see the link I posted earlier.
